I'm trying to rync working between the UK (Sun box) and India (AIX box) and
am having a real problems getting it up and running because every time I do
a full transfer it hangs.  The Sun box is the one holding the canonical
source which we want to mirror.

I've been shipped to the India office to get this working and have tried
hundreds of things over the last week, I've also scoured the web looking for
solutions (which is how I found this mailing list)!  

I put a load of tracing into the rsync  code and discovered that it was
waiting on the child to die.  A bit more  tracking down showed that the
child process was the remsh to the AIX box.  This is what is hanging. 

The interesting bit is that the remsh closes down at the AIX end without 
problem but doesn't seem to be telling the other end that it has finished so
you end up with a one ended hanging remsh and rsync waiting for it to die...

I'm tried it from both a Linux box and a Sun box at the UK end so it's
probably this end that's causing the trouble.  I'm trying to get access to a
Sun box here.  The local UNIX guru thinks there is a problem with the TCP/IP
socket shutdown on AIX, does that ring any bells with anyone?
